Position Overview & Responsibilities for the Desktop Support Technician:
- Provide proficient hardware, software, and networking support
- Utilize operating systems such as Remedy, Zabbix, Maquetador – DAM, Power BI
- Manage device lifecycle using CMDB and Remedy Asset Manager
- Diagnose and resolve technical issues efficiently
- Monitor, update, and manage support tickets daily
Required Skills for the Desktop Support Technician:
- Fluency in Spanish and English
- Experience with hardware/software types: NCR, Toshiba
- Familiarity with device types: Bluebird, Zebra, iOS
- Strong analytical and troubleshooting abilities
- Excellent customer service and technical support skills
- Ability to explain technical issues or solutions to non-technical users
- Experience in prioritizing and managing multiple open incidents or requests
